## What is the Evaluation of Governance Model Evaluation?

⎊ A Governance Model Evaluation within c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ives assesses the efficacy of established protocols for decision-making and risk mitigation. This process quantifies the alignment between stated objectives and actual operational outcomes, focusing on the robustness of control mechanisms. Effective evaluations incorporate scenario analysis, stress testing, and backtesting to identify vulnerabilities and potential systemic risks, particularly concerning dec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s) and complex derivative structures. The ultimate aim is to enhance transparency and accountability, fostering confidence among participants and regulators.

## What is the Adjustment of Governance Model Evaluation?

⎊ Continuous adjustment of governance frameworks is critical given the dynamic nature of digital asset markets and evolving regulatory landscapes. Real-time monitoring of key performance indicators (KPIs), such as transaction throughput, oracle reliability, and smart contract security, informs iterative improvements to existing protocols. Adjustments often involve modifications to consensus mechanisms, parameter calibrations within automated market makers (AMMs), and the implementation of circuit breakers to manage extreme volatility. Proactive adaptation minimizes counterparty risk and ensures the long-term viability of the system.

## What is the Algorithm of Governance Model Evaluation?

⎊ The underlying algorithm governing a governance model significantly impacts its responsiveness and efficiency. Algorithmic governance utilizes pre-defined rules and automated processes to execute decisions, reducing human intervention and potential biases. Within options trading and derivatives, algorithms manage collateralization ratios, margin requirements, and liquidation protocols, ensuring stability during periods of market stress. The design of these algorithms must account for game-theoretic considerations, preventing manipulation and ensuring fair outcomes for all stakeholders, while also incorporating robust error handling and fail-safe mechanisms.
